在上一节 「手把你教你安装Linux虚拟机」 里,我们已经安装好了Linux虚拟机,在这一节里,我们将配置安装好的Linux虚拟机,使其达到可以开发的程度。Ubuntu刚安装完毕之后,还无法进行开发,因为有些环境还未设置好,比如:升级vi到vim,源的更换,等等。在对Ubuntu进行配置时,命令行窗口(Shell)是必须的,但Ubuntu默认未将这个命令行窗口放在左边任务栏里,因此我
一:首先现在 red hat 的镜像(我使用red hat 7),下载以后把它放在一个你知道的文件夹中。然后下载虚拟机,把他安装好。然后 打开虚拟机,新建虚拟机。我点了第二个自定义。 这里点稍后安装: 然后一直下一步,下一步。假装这里有个分割线。。。。。。。。然后点 虚拟机 ,点设置(如果是灰色不可选的,把虚拟机关机就好了),然后 这里CD/D
一、前言 大早上的,兴冲冲的打开虚拟机,结果死活登不上。此时确定密码是没问题的。网上百度一下才知道原来是环境变量的原因。突然想起来昨天刚安装golang环境,修改了环境变量的/etc/environment文件。那么问题就很明显了,改回来。关于搭建golang的环境: 二、解决过程1、从图形界面转到命令行此处根据操作系统各不相同
功能概述生成gpg密钥,keysize设置为2046长度,过期期限设置无限导出公钥上传到debian、ubuntu和openpgp网站下载公钥到本地导入公钥/私钥到本地签名文件 + 检查文件签名加密文件 + 解密文件加密签名文件 + 解密验证文件需求背景debian上游推包需要,debian上游源码包也有签名机制现实中怎么使用这个算法,对信息加密和解密。这要用到GnuPG软件(简称GPG),它是目
参考资料 http://www.gnupg.org/howtos/zh/GPGMiniHowto-3.html 例子:1、先产生密钥对
#gpg --gen-key
这样会在用户家目录生成一个./gnupg的目录,然后会要求你回答一系列问题,前面三个按默认即可。
进入到real name,是要求你输入用户ID,注意姓名要5个字符长。这里假设为davidway
在Email a
GnuPG(GNU Privacy Guard,简称:GPG)为一款免费开源的使用非对称密钥加密(asymmetric cryptography)之软件,最初由Werner Koch开发,该软件使用非对称密钥(亦称公开密钥加密)提高加密速度,使用公钥便于交换。 GnuPG是自由软件基金会的GNU计划的一部份,与2000年开始接受德国政府资助。以GNU通用公共许可证第三版授权。本次实验是用自己的笔记
文章目录Linux下使用GPG(GnuPG)加密及解密文件1. 简介2.环境及版本3.GPG公钥生成4.查看公钥5.查看私钥6.导出公钥7.导出私钥8.加密文件本机加密其他电脑加密9.解密文件本机解密其他电脑解密10.卸载密钥对 Linux下使用GPG(GnuPG)加密及解密文件1. 简介GNU Privacy Guard(GnuPG或GPG)是一种加密软件,它是PGP加密软件的满足GPL的替代
Linux操作形式一、文件管理1.文件系统的概述2.文件类型3.Linux目录介绍---就像一棵树3.1树型目录结构3.2工作目录与用户主目录3.3Linux目录介绍—绝对路径与相对路径3.4文件与目录的基本操作---目录操作命令3.5文件与目录的基本操作---文件操作命令 一、文件管理1.文件系统的概述指文件在存储介质上存放及存储的组织方法和数据结构。2.文件类型(1)普通文件第一个字符为[
目标:使用 GPG 加密文件发行版:适用于任何发行版要求:安装了 GPG 的 Linux 或者拥有 root 权限来安装它。难度:简单约定:# - 需要使用 root 权限来执行指定命令,可以直接使用 root 用户来执行,也可以使用 sudo命令$ - 可以使用普通用户来执行指定命令介绍加密非常重要。它对于保护敏感信息来说是必不可少的。你的私人文件应该要被加密,而 GPG 提供了很好的解决方案。
如何安UEFI+GPT系统首先简单了解一下UEFI+GPT与LEGACY+MBR的区别UEFI采用快速启动模式,在开机速度上占据很大优势,几乎是在点击电源键出现电脑标志后就能直接进入系统(也跟电脑性能有关);而传统模式虽然也能够安装win10(win10自带快速开机),但是开机时也需要加载一段时间。常见问题现在电脑几乎都支持UEFI启动模式,但是由于在后期系统崩溃或是其他原因重装时,可能会发现系统
Linux:shell之编程免交互一、Here Document 免交互1.1 Here Document 免交互概述1.2 语法格式1.3 操作二、Expect 命令2.1 Expect 概述2.2 基本命令2.3 操作 一、Here Document 免交互1.1 Here Document 免交互概述使用I/O重定向的方式将命令列表提供给交互式程序或命令,比如 ftp、cat 或 read
0.前言Spark集群搭建在Hadoop集群之上,而Hadoop运行过程中需要管理远端Hadoop守护进程,在Hadoop启动以后,NameNode是通过SSH(Secure Shell)来启动和停止各个DataNode上的各种守护进程的。这就必须在节点之间执行指令的时候是不需要输入密码的形式,故我们需要配置SSH运用无密码公钥认证的形式,这样NameNode使用SSH无密码登录并启动DataNa
从源码到编译的过程(加粗命令) 从软件官网或者git服务器checkout下来:git chone --recursive htttps://*.git -b v1.0(#github 加速:https://gh.api.99988866.xyz/ + URL) 进入到源码目录 dh_make --createorig ,将源码debian化(d
主要内容:GPG加密解密的基本操作与少量应用。简介安装生成密钥操作过程对密钥的一些操作查看密钥导出密钥导入密钥注销密钥删除密钥编辑密钥签名修改密码等……加密文件解密文件一些参考简介GPG——GnuPG,是一种非对称密钥加密工具软件,主要用于加密解密,进行数字签名等。GPG可以生成用于加密解密、进行数字签名、数据指纹的非对称密钥。安装目前UBUNTU默认已经安装了GPG,编译安装可参考中文版Howt
现在很多程序员都应用GCC,怎样才能更好的应用GCC。目前,GCC可以用来编译C/C++、FORTRAN、JAVA、OBJC、ADA等语言的程序,可根据需要选择安装支持的语言。本文以在Redhat Linux安装GCC4.1.2为例(因在项目开发过程中要求使用,没有用最新的GCC版本),介绍Linux安装GCC过程。
安装之前,系统中必须要有cc或者gcc等编译器,并且是可用的,或者用环境变量C
参考: 如何在 Gitee 上使用 GPG 我们通过在本地主机保存GPG私钥,然后在Gitee或Github上保存GPG公钥的方式来实现对git的comm
使用gogs,drone,docker搭建自动部署测试环境Gogs是一个使用go语言开发的自助git服务,支持所有平台Docker是使用go开发的开源容器引擎Drone是一个基于容器技术的持续集成平台。每个构建都在一个临时的Docker容器中执行,使开发人员能够完全控制其构建环境并保证隔离。drone易于安装和使用,其目标是替代jenkins本文所实现的的功能为当你push代码到gogs时,自动更
本主题从较高的层次讲述了与邮件安全明确相关的公钥加密元素。此外,还有其他一些资料,您可以参考这些资料,以便更深入地了解该主题。密码学是一门研究如何通过使用代码和密码来保护信息的学科。密码学形成了邮件安全的基础部分。 简单来说,编码是系统地更改信息以使其不可读(并无从了解该信息是如何改变的)的过程。最早也是最简单的代码之一(称为恺撒密码)是通过采用字母表并使所有字母移动固定的位数而产生的。发件人和收
虚拟机安装步骤打开VMware Workstation,点击创建新的虚拟机。点击自定义(高级)(C),下一步。选择虚拟机硬件兼容性 Workstation 15.x,下一步。选择稍后安装操作系统,下一步。选择Linux(L),Red Hat Enterprise Linux8 64 位,下一步。虚拟机名称(便于了解目的的名字);选择安装位置(尽量避免选择系统工作盘),下一步。默认处理器:1;每个处
转载
2023-11-01 20:50:37
529阅读
文章目录0、GnuPG 公用说明0.1 词汇0.2 功能0.3 使用过程(加密与签名)1、生成密钥1.1 生成主密钥1.2 创建子密钥1.2.1 创建具有签名功能的子密钥【S】1.2.2 创建具有验证功能的子密钥【A】2、密钥管理2.1 列出密钥2.2 删除密钥2.2.1 删除密钥2.2.2 删除子密钥2.3 输出密钥2.4 上传公钥2.5 公钥指纹2.6 导入密钥3、加密和解密3.1 加密3.